这篇文章将为大家详细讲解有关jquery如何让页面有表头,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。
让页面拥有表头:jQuery 方法
引言
表头是网页页面中至关重要的一部分,它能提供页面内容的简要概述,并允许用户轻松浏览和查找特定信息。jQuery 提供了一种简单的机制,可以动态地将表头添加到网页中。
方法
jQuery 提供了 <thead>
元素,它将创建表头,并将其置于表元素的顶部。要使用 jQuery 动态添加表头,可以遵循以下步骤:
1. 创建包含表头的 HTML
<thead>
<tr>
<th>列 1</th>
<th>列 2</th>
<th>列 3</th>
</tr>
</thead>
2. 将 HTML 插入到表中
使用 jQuery 的 prepend()
方法,将 <thead>
HTML 插入到表元素中:
$(tableSelector).prepend("<thead></thead>");
3. 使用 html()
方法添加表头内容
使用 html()
方法,将表头内容添加到 <thead>
元素中:
$("thead").html("<tr><th>ID</th><th>姓名</th><th>电子邮件</th></tr>");
4. 添加样式(可选)
为了使表头在页面上美观地呈现,可以添加样式以设置表头背景、文本对齐和字体样式等属性:
thead {
background: #ccc;
font-weight: bold;
text-align: center;
}
示例
考虑以下 HTML 表:
<table>
<tbody>
<tr>
<td>1</td>
<td>John Doe</td>
<td>johndoe@example.com</td>
</tr>
<tr>
<td>2</td>
<td>Jane Smith</td>
<td>janesmith@example.com</td>
</tr>
</tbody>
</table>
要将表头添加到此表,可以使用以下 jQuery 代码:
$("table").prepend("<thead></thead>");
$("thead").html("<tr><th>ID</th><th>姓名</th><th>电子邮件</th></tr>");
运行此代码将向表中添加一个表头,其中包含 "ID"、"姓名" 和 "电子邮件" 列。
替代方法
除了使用 jQuery 外,还可以使用 CSS <thead>
选择器来设置表头样式。该选择器仅适用于表中的 <thead>
元素,从而提供了一种更简洁的方法来设置表头样式。
优点
- 方便、动态地添加表头。
- 允许精细控制表头内容和样式。
- 与其他 jQuery 操作无缝集成。
缺点
- 需要了解 jQuery 语法。
- 可能会增加网页的复杂性。
结论
通过利用 jQuery 的 <thead>
元素和相关方法,可以轻松地在网页中创建和自定义表头。这对于组织和显示数据表中的信息至关重要,并增强了用户体验。
以上就是jquery如何让页面有表头的详细内容,更多请关注编程学习网其它相关文章!